- Denis WhiteMar 23, 2023 · 3 years agoPayPal takes tax reporting for cryptocurrency transactions seriously. When you buy, sell, or hold cryptocurrency using PayPal, they provide you with the necessary tax documents and information to help you accurately report your transactions. This includes a Form 1099-K if you meet certain criteria, which shows the total payment volume received through PayPal. It's important to note that PayPal is not responsible for determining your tax obligations, so it's always a good idea to consult with a tax professional for specific advice.
